自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

ERP开发

交流

  • 博客(80)
  • 资源 (3)
  • 收藏
  • 关注

原创 C# DataGridView显示行号的三种方法

方法一:网上最常见的做法是用DataGridView的RowPostPaint事件在RowHeaderCell中绘制行号:private void dgGrid_RowPostPaint(object sender, DataGridViewRowPostPaintEventArgs e)  {      var grid = sender as DataGridV

2016-11-26 16:08:27 7801

转载 C#调用带返回值的存储过程

C#调用带返回值的存储过程(1)在SQL Server中建立如下的存储过程:set ANSI_NULLS ONset QUOTED_IDENTIFIER ONGOCREATE PROCEDURE [dbo].[GetNameById] @studentid varchar(8), @studentname nvarchar(50) OUTPUTASBEGIN

2016-11-16 11:25:07 542 2

转载 C#转发邮件

public void SendMailLocalhost()  {  System.Net.Mail.MailMessage msg = new System.Net.Mail.MailMessage();  msg.To.Add("a@a.com");  msg.To.Add("b@b.com");  /* msg.To.Add("b@b.com");  * msg.T

2016-10-31 11:42:44 726

原创 如何发布内网网站到外网

路由器分配的固定公网IP,且有路由器管理权限,网站服务器部署在路由器内部网络。如何将网站发布到外网大众访问?解决方案就是:在路由器上做端口映射,允许外网访问网站端口。工具/原料服务器路由方法/步骤1,明确网站内网访问地址端口,确保网站服务正常,在内网可以正常访问连接。如我内网网站访问地址

2016-09-20 08:46:44 2755

原创 C#实现限制软件的使用次数

实例说明 为了使软件能被更广泛的推广,开发商希望能有更多的用户使用软件,但他们又不想让用户长时间免费使用未经授权的软件,这时就可以推出试用版软件,限制用户的使用次数,当用户感觉使用方便的话,可以花钱获取注册码,以获取其正式版软件。本实例使用C#实现了限制软件使用次数功能,运行本实例,如果程序未注册,则提示用户已经使用过几次,如图1所示,然后进入程序主窗体,单击主窗体中的“注册”按钮,弹出如图2

2016-08-23 23:02:11 5736 2

原创 利用命令提示符转换硬盘模式

win10 硬盘模式一般为gpt,而win7等一般为mbr,相互转换时可以使用安装光盘里系统带的命令提示符实现1.使用Win7 8光盘或者U盘引导,进入系统安装界面。如果出现此系统只能安装在gpt或mbr模式的硬盘时,使用下面的命令语句转换。2.  按Shift + F10打开命令提示符。3.输入”Diskpart”(不用输入引号,下同),并按回车。4.输入:”list disk”

2016-07-19 13:58:53 1570

原创 ASP.NET 序列化

using System;using System.Collections.Generic;using System.Web.Script.Serialization;using System.Configuration;using System.Runtime.Serialization.Json;using System.Runtime.Serialization;us

2016-06-24 19:26:07 370

原创 C# WINFORM DATAGRIDVIEW 单元格添加 按钮

这一节大家共同学习下自定义的datagridview, 这个datagridview的主要功能是可以使datagridview中的某些列包含按钮,单击按钮可以触发相应的事件。我们先来看下效果图吧!  下面我们来说下实现步骤  1.创建自定义控件    创建一个自定义控件,添加新项---自定义控件 2.实现自定义datagridview控件  使刚创建的自定义控件继承

2016-03-26 10:49:33 13304 2

原创 SQL存储过程展易飞BOM

create TABLE ZBOMCB1(--BOM展开表算表CB001 CHAR(20) NOT NULL,CB005 CHAR(20) NOT NULL,CB008 numeric(16) NOT NULL)CREATE PROCEDURE ZGetBOM3Level as       --使用游标展算BOM插ZBOMCB1  delete from Z

2016-03-23 14:49:09 1579

转载 K3 登陆错误提示 错误代码:1726(6BEH) 的解决方法

今天一上班,突然全部客户端出现登陆不上服务器状况。 金碟K/3在登录时提示:定义的应用程序或对象错误错误代码:1726(6BEH)Source :KDLoginDetail :Automation 错误 经过在社区的搜索及实际上机解决,问题解决了。 解决方法如下:(下面操作是针对服务器的操作,不是针对客户端做如下操作)       1、右键“我的电脑”,

2016-01-05 21:40:21 4082

转载 C# RDLC 绑定

public partial class Form1 : Form    {        public Form1()        {            InitializeComponent();        }        private void Form1_Load(object sender, EventArgs e)        {

2015-12-29 12:13:29 607

原创 SQL 存储过程动态生成列

USE [BM]GO/****** Object:  StoredProcedure [dbo].[zsp_weekneedata]    Script Date: 2015-12-19 15:36:09 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GO ALTER procedure [dbo].[zsp_wee

2015-12-19 15:44:26 948

原创 自定义起始及截止日期,计算周期 函数

USE [BM]GO/****** Object:  UserDefinedFunction [dbo].[ZfunWeek]    Script Date: 2015-12-19 15:30:36 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OALTER function  [dbo].[ZfunWeek](@

2015-12-19 15:38:30 2095

转载 C# DATATABLE

今天碰到一个需求,就是将下面表(1)格式的数据转换为表(2)格式的数据。很明显,这是一个行转列的要求,本想在数据库中行转列,因为在数据库中行转列是比较简单的,方法可以参考本站SQLServer中(行列转换)行转列及列转行且加平均值及汇总值,但因其它需求,最终需将该转化搬到C#中进行了。客户名称日期金额(表1)客户名称日期金额A客户1月1000

2015-12-15 22:57:57 475 1

转载 SQL 最日期

1,sql语句中获取datetime的日期部分 .2,sql语句中 经常操作操作datetime类型数据。3.主要方法还是通过日期格式的转换来获取。如下:     convert语法:convert(类型type,表达式/字段,style样式) style样式限于DateTime类型.Select CONVERT(varchar(

2015-06-03 11:52:11 348

转载 C#生成条码

C#利用Zxing.net生成条形码和二维码并实现打印的功能    开篇:zxing.net是.net平台下编解条形码和二维码的工具。         下载地址:http://pan.baidu.com/s/1kTr3VufStep1:使用VS2010新建一个窗体程序项目:Step2:添加三个类:分别是BarCodeClass.cs、DocementBase.cs、imageD

2015-04-30 10:05:07 771 1

原创 问题解决:“无任何网络提供程序接受指定的网络路径”的解决方法

今天碰到这个问题,打开 \\10.1.1.6,往常可以打开的共享,这会居然不行,提示:\\10.1.1.6无任何网络提供程序接受指定的网络路径。遂搜之,找到原因并且找到了解决办法:原因:workstation,server,computer browser这三个服务无法启动解决方案:1.服务停止了:一般有workstation,server,comput

2015-02-28 11:57:39 47937

原创 EXCEL工作表保护密码破解方式

Excel工作表密码保护的解除方法Excel弹出“您试图更改的单元格或图表受保护,因而是只读的。若要修改受保护单元格或图表,请先使用‘撤消工作表保护’命令(在‘审阅’选项卡的‘更改’组中)来取消保护。可能会提示您输入密码。  出现这种情况,应该怎么解决呢?经过研究,找到了两种破解Excel工作表保护码的方法。  一、VBA宏代码破解法:  第一步:打开该文件

2015-01-23 08:50:04 5005

原创 SQL角脚本语句修改表名及字段名

//修改表字段名EXEC sp_rename '表名.字段名' ,'新字段名' ,'column'exec sp_rename 'invmback.COMPANY','company','column'//改修表名sp_rename '旧表名' ,'新表名'

2015-01-12 15:54:49 683

原创 易飞ERP进货单单身只显示审核账号未显示审核名称

查询原来是权限表的问题 ADMMF增加一条记录()

2015-01-07 09:50:26 979

转载 简单水晶报表PUSH模式制作

利用CrystalReport与C#生成报表(vs2010+sql2008) 请看图1,这份报表有多复杂?猜猜它需要多少时间完成?就复杂而言,它只是一份简单的、从Share>Student (SQL Server 2008)中提取出来的报表;就时间而言,相信不会花你很多时间吧。开始之前说明:VS2010本身是没有CrystalReport。要进行下载安装。安装成功之后,就可以继续完

2014-12-24 14:13:59 1596 2

原创 数据表报《提取逻辑页失败》损坏

1,错误图2.解决方法,--检查数据表问题 图2use databasename;--数据库名godbcc checktable("dbo.表名");--表名go3.备份报错的数据表,再新建一张一模一样的表,再把备份的数据表INSERT

2014-12-23 09:59:47 1905

原创 C#运行水晶报表出错

因为  APP.CONFIG文件 未添加  红色字体部分属性                                connectionString="Data Source=.;Initial Catalog=BM;User ID=sa;Password=ccwen"            providerName="System.Data.SqlCl

2014-12-22 23:19:21 916

原创 C# 使用GDI绘图技术

//创建GDI对象 由于Graphics 类为密封类,不能被实例化但可以通过其它类方法去创建下面以button类为例创建 Graphics//实例化randomRandom random=new Random();//创建Graphics            Graphics graphics = button1.CreateGraphics();           

2014-12-08 09:01:17 805

原创 易飞工单已完工领料控制

第1步:设计录入工单及录入变列单自定义画面: 工单单头设置 自定义字段组合框,值:L:正常领料, N:不可领料 第2步: 设置 工单发放及手工新建 工单时事件触发 给工单单头 自定义字段赋默认值( L:正常领料);第3步: 在入库审核时设置 触 发传值 当工单单头状态 =Y 时 传值 给自定义字段  值(N:不可领料 )第3步:   在领料单单身编写SQL触发器 使当工单单头自定义

2014-12-05 10:22:32 3712

原创 C#MD5加密16进制写法

using System;using System.Collections.Generic;using System.Linq;using System.Text;using System.Security.Cryptography;namespace Md5{    class Program    {        static void Main(st

2014-12-03 22:42:28 4050

原创 WPF lisview 绑定数据

ListView Height="264" HorizontalAlignment="Left" Margin="28,84,0,0" Name="listView1" VerticalAlignment="Top" Width="526" >           ListView.View>               GridView x:Name="gri

2014-11-24 23:31:40 788

原创 易飞自定义SQL自定义月结日期取月份函数

ALTER function Fun_Date(@Date char(2),@dates DATETIME ) returns char(2)--输入as--给出日期计算月结数函数, begin              declare  @RtDate char(12)         if(convert(int,@Date)         set @RtDate

2014-11-24 15:44:10 1077

原创 C# linq 书写语法

var  list = f

2014-11-23 19:51:50 576

原创 Excel 表内金额小写转大写函数

=IF(A1<0,"无效金额",IF(A1<1,"",TEXT(INT(A1),"[DBNUM2]")&"元")&IF(--RIGHT(TEXT(A1,"0.00"),2)=0,IF(A1=0,"零元","")&"整",IF(INT(A1*10)=0,"",TEXT(INT(A1*10)-INT(A1)*10,"[DBNUM2]"))&IF(INT(A1*10)=0,"","角")&IF(INT(

2014-11-13 08:54:03 831

原创 SQL数据用于易飞数据库值部门,客户,供应商代码(标量函数)返回名称

USE [BM]GO/****** Object:  UserDefinedFunction [dbo].[Z_GetCustVenderDeptName]    Script Date: 2014/11/12 15:54:22 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OALTER FUNCTION [dbo

2014-11-12 16:04:15 667

转载 C# DataGridVieW 数据转出Excel文

用流保存成xls文件. 这种方法比较好,不用引用Excel组件.   下面是具体例子,可以参考usingSystem.IO;               ///       /// 另存新档按钮       ///        private void SaveAs()//另存新档按钮  导出成Excel       {    

2014-10-28 19:00:31 507

原创 易飞9.07衍生字段删除问题

易飞9.07, 所有客户

2014-10-28 15:36:29 542

原创 易飞9.07衍生字段删除问题

易飞9.07, 所有电脑上操作都 无法删除,自定义报表里的衍生字段,双击,ESC键,是不是只能通过后后删除,请大家分享下

2014-10-28 15:36:20 755

原创 品号保存领料数量不可于工单需领数量

create trigger trigger_moctea  --品号保存领料数量不可于工单需领数量 on MOCTE FOR insert,update as begin   declare @TE011 CHAR(4),@TE012 CHAR(12),@TE004 CHAR (30)--,@TE005 decimal(20)  declare @TB004 de

2014-09-18 09:24:17 1306

原创 C# 为表添加主键ID

// 申请一个列数组集合DataCol

2014-07-24 11:54:10 1820

原创 C#委托处理方法

delegate double MathAction(double num);    class DelegateTest    {        // Regular method that matches signature:        //定义静态方示(传入参数)        static double Double(double input)       

2014-07-23 15:37:33 614

原创 C## LinQ用法

1. i定义数组或集合int[] I_name=i

2014-07-22 14:05:39 436

原创 WPF中datePicker1控件获取中的日期格试为YYYY-MM-DD 转换成yyyMMdd格式

1.系统默认转换前的格式  代码如下   textBox3.Text = datePicker1.Text;

2014-07-22 13:22:32 7983 1

原创 利用字符截取函数substring,charindex replace 等函数定义标量函数

--把包装方法自动计算成件数BEGIN declare @A CHAR(20) declare @num intselect top 1 @A=UDF02 from COPTH WHERE UDF02=@UDF02if (CHARINDEX('*',@A)>0 AND CHARINDEX('+',@A)beginSET @num= CONVERT(int,substri

2014-07-17 17:36:29 739

DataGridView列自动筛选

研究好久才搞明白,其实很简单

2017-07-20

C# 232调式

C# 232调式

2017-07-16

易助数据库连接配置失败

FA

2017-07-16

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除